Background

Tina M. Bell is a Partner at Christie Bell & Marshall in Indianapolis, Indiana, specializing in medical malpractice litigation. Admitted to the Indiana bar in 1998, she spent over a decade as a defense attorney representing doctors, nurses, hospitals, and insurers, and tried over 20 cases to verdict as defense counsel. In 2009, she transitioned to plaintiff representation, dedicating her practice to representing victims of medical malpractice. Her practice areas include medical malpractice, birth injury, wrongful death, and toxic IVF culture media litigation.
